Learning Goals
Day 1 (1.5 hours)
-Learn the best ways to fight the Wither
-Construct a beacon

Day 2 (1.5 hours)
-Discover the mobs associated with the Ocean Monument
-Fight the Elder Guardians and uncover rare loot

Day 3 (1.5 hours)
-Explore a Woodland Mansion and learn how to fight the Evoker, Vex, and Illusioner mobs
-Learn about the different types of potions and hunt down the ingredients to make them.

Day 4 (1.5 hours)
-Learn about two unique structures in the game: the Bastion Remnant and the End City
-Practice fighting the mobs found in both 
-Loot both structures to uncover treasures like the elytra, netherite, and diamond tools

Day 5 (1.5 hours)
-Learn about the Deep Dark biome and the Ancient City
-Learn the best ways to fight the Warden

Playful Digital Learning consists of people with a passion for teaching, gaming, and technology. We strive to inspire creativity, model reflection, and empower students to learn through play. Our teachers often have experience teaching both in person and online.

The founder of Playful Digital Learning, Yoonhee Lee, has done extensive research on game-based literacy learning. She has a variety of teaching experience in K-12 and adult contexts in Korea and the US. She is currently teaching pre-service teachers in Mary Lou Fulton Teachers College at ASU. Her research topic is focusing on gaming and learning. 

Teacher Joshua Watkins is a current student at San Diego Mesa College pursuing a degree in History.  He loves to see kids' confidence improve and their creativity shine through Minecraft.  He has played the game since 2011, and has skill sets in both the survival and creative gamemodes.

Teacher, Michelle Resubal, is a current student at San Diego State University pursuing a degree in Psychology. She enjoys using her creativity and leadership skills to work with students and provide a welcoming Minecraft experience. She has played Minecraft since 2020 and is experienced in both survival and creative aspects of the game.
